Definitions from Wiktionary (crag)

noun:  (Northern England) A rocky outcrop; a rugged steep cliff or rock.
noun:  A rough, broken fragment of rock.
noun:  (geology) A partially compacted bed of gravel mixed with shells, of the Pliocene to Pleistocene epochs.
noun:  (uncountable) A game played with three dice, similar to Yahtzee.
noun:  (dialectal or obsolete) The neck or throat.
